THE LEEDS ERUV 

The objects arc to advance the Orthodox Jewish faith, in particular by promoting Sabbath observance among adherents of the faith by: - the establishment and maintenance of an eruv- the promotion of Orthodox Jewish teaching concerning the observance of the Sabbath.
Analysis by Giving is Great

Regulatory & Governance issues to consider:

  • There are only 4 trustees
  • The Board composition appears to be rather static

Financial issues to consider:

  • A PartB annual return has not been required and so detailed financial information is not available from the online data
  • Income has been volatile recently and was significantly lower than spending in the latest year
